Investment Casting

Investment casting is used for complex metal components that require fine details, tight geometry, and reliable material performance. It is suitable for stainless steel, alloy steel, carbon steel, titanium, and specialty alloys.

Typical uses: precision parts, complex shapes, industrial and aerospace components.

Die Casting

Die casting supports repeatable production of metal parts where dimensional consistency, surface quality, and production efficiency are important. It is commonly used for aluminum, zinc, and other non-ferrous metal components.

Typical uses: high-volume parts, housings, brackets, and engineered metal components.

Forging

Forging is used for metal components that require strength, toughness, and dependable mechanical properties. It is a strong choice for demanding applications where part durability matters.

Typical uses: load-bearing parts, industrial hardware, machinery, and transportation components.

CNC Machining

CNC machining provides dimensional accuracy and finishing support for cast, forged, and machined metal components. It can be used for prototypes, secondary machining, and production-ready parts.

Typical uses: precision features, drilled holes, milled surfaces, threaded parts, and finished components.

Stainless Steel Casting

Stainless steel casting is suitable for parts that require corrosion resistance, strength, and long-term reliability in industrial, energy, medical, and chemical processing environments.

Typical uses: corrosion-resistant components, valves, fittings, housings, and process equipment parts.

Titanium Casting

Titanium casting supports specialized components where lightweight performance, corrosion resistance, and material strength are important. It is often considered for aerospace, medical, marine, and high-performance industrial applications.

Typical uses: lightweight parts, corrosion-resistant components, and specialized engineered applications.

Sand Casting

Sand casting is a flexible process for larger components, lower-volume production, and parts where tooling cost and design adaptability are important considerations.

Typical uses: large castings, industrial parts, machinery components, and lower-volume projects.

Secondary Operations

Secondary operations help convert cast or forged parts into finished, application-ready components through machining, finishing, surface treatment, assembly, and inspection support.

Typical uses: finishing, machining, coating, assembly, inspection, and documentation support.

How We Help Customers Choose the Right Process

Different manufacturing processes fit different part requirements. ForceBeyond helps customers evaluate the best path based on design, material, volume, performance, and quality needs.

  • Part geometry and design complexity
  • Material requirements and mechanical properties
  • Annual quantity and production volume
  • Tolerance, machining, and surface finish needs
  • Application environment and performance requirements
  • Inspection, documentation, and quality requirements
